Understanding Printing Paper Types

Printing paper comes in numerous types, each specifically developed for different applications. Below is a detailed breakdown of the most typical types of printing paper.

Paper TypeDescriptionFinest Used For
Bond PaperLightweight and resilient, usually used for daily printing.Reports, letters, and memos
Text PaperThicker than bond A4 Paper Discounts, providing a smooth finish.Books, pamphlets, and leaflets
Cover StockHeavier and more rigid, frequently utilized for cardstock.Service cards, postcards, and covers
Glossy PaperCoated paper that provides a shiny surface, perfect for photos.Photo printing and marketing materials
Matte PaperNon-reflective, supplying a more subdued surface.Art prints and high-end documents
Recycled A4 Paper In PacksMade from post-consumer waste, environment-friendly alternative.General printing and eco-conscious prints
Specialized PaperIncludes textured, colored, and other unique documents.Invitations, certificates, and imaginative projects

The Role of Paper Weight and Thickness

The weight of paper is determined in grams per square meter (GSM) or pounds (pound). The higher the GSM or poundage, the thicker and more significant the paper. Here are some typical weight classifications:

Weight CategoryGSM RangeTypical Uses
Lightweight70-100 GSMStandard letterhead and daily prints
Midweight100-180 GSMBrochures, flyers, and posters
Heavyweight180-300 GSMBusiness cards, invitations, and art prints
Ultra Heavyweight300 GSM and aboveHigh-end product packaging and great art prints

Aspects to Consider When Choosing Printing Paper

Choosing the right printing paper includes considering different factors to ensure the very best results. Here are some crucial factors to consider:

  1. Purpose of the Print: Understand what you are printing and for whom. Organization reports may require various paper than marketing pamphlets.

  2. Type of Printer: Inkjet and printer have different compatibilities with paper types. Always check compatibility to avoid jams or poor printing quality.

  3. End up: Decide in between shiny, matte, or textured finishes based upon the desired aesthetic and functionality.

  4. Color vs. Black and White: Color prints frequently look much better on glossy or semi-gloss papers, while black-and-white prints may gain a classic search matte or textured documents.

  5. Cost: Quality paper can be more expensive; balance quality with budget restraints. Consider Bulk Copy Paper purchases for expense effectiveness.

Tips for Storing and Handling Printing Paper

Appropriate storage and handling of printing paper can maintain its quality. Consider the following ideas:

  1. Store in a Climate-Controlled Environment: Extreme humidity or dryness can warp paper. Keep it in a cool, dry space.

  2. Avoid Direct Sunlight: Prolonged direct exposure to sunshine can trigger fading and discoloration.

  3. Avoid Stacking Too High: Excess weight can trigger flexing or warping. Shop in flat stacks when possible.

  4. Manage with Clean Hands: Oil and dirt from hands can impact the A4 Paper Pack quality. Constantly manage with care.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is the best type of paper for printing pictures?

Glossy paper is typically chosen for printing photos, as it enhances color and contrast for a lively finish.

2. Can I utilize recycled paper in a laser printer?

Yes, many recycled paper works with printer. However, it's vital to look for the suggested weight and thickness.

3. Is more pricey paper worth the cost?

In the majority of cases, yes. Investing in quality paper can lead to better print results, which can favorably impact your branding and image.

4. What weight of paper should I use for company cards?

For business cards, heavyweight paper (around 250-300 GSM) is recommended to guarantee sturdiness and an expert feel.

5. How do I choose paper for sales brochures?

Pick a paper type that stabilizes quality and budget. Midweight text paper is typically ideal, supplying a good feel while being affordable.
